In a previous thread, Silvercar suggested the Nissan OEM t3 gasket. I Went down to the dealership and picked one up, and its freakin awesome. Super super thick, looks strong, cheap ($14) and best part, re-usable! That's right, they are meant to be re-used!Beats the thin ATP steel ones.
Here's a picture:
It's for a Turbo Z31 300zx I believe, part number : 14415-4P200

Here is the part # part # 14415-17M00 for the T25 people mani crew.. Its from 94-95 300zx twin turbo..
